WebThe answer to whether “yeet” has been added to the dictionary is yes. Although yeet has its origins in African-American Vernacular English (AAVE), its usage has spread and evolved to be used as a versatile exclamation or interjection meaning to throw something energetically, with power and velocity, or to express excitement or enthusiasm.
